The Portwest Bizflame Work Lightweight FR Shirt is expertly designed for professionals seeking comfort and safety in hazardous environments. Crafted from a highly innovative flame-resistant fabric with anti-static properties, this lightweight shirt ensures optimal protection against radiant, convective, and contact heat. Enhanced with high-visibility reflective tape, it guarantees visibility while you work, while the tailored design keeps the shirt tucked in without compromising mobility. Featuring adjustable button cuffs and flapped chest pockets, this shirt is Ideal for those who require functionality and style without sacrificing safety.

Lightweight construction enhances wearer comfort throughout the day

Offers multi-norm protection against various heat hazards

Two chest pockets provide secure storage with button and flap closure

Includes a pen division on the left pocket for easy access

The button front closure ensures a secure and comfortable fit

Features premium sew-on flame-resistant reflective tape for increased visibility

Equipped with radio loops for convenient clipping of communication devices

40+ UPF rated fabric effectively blocks 98% of UV rays, ensuring sun protection

Suitable for use in ATEX environments, meeting stringent safety regulations
